Real-world circumstances, not rote learning

You can memorize the healing position and still freeze when a good friend is encounter down on the pavement. Scenario-based knowing appear that barrier. In a well-run Oxley emergency treatment program, you ought to anticipate to role-play, to relocate furnishings, to listen to history noise while you call emergency services, and to deal with a "individual" that does not work together perfectly. You ought to obtain perspiring practicing kid mouth-to-mouth resuscitation on a smaller manikin after you have already pushed your limits on a grown-up version. You need to really feel the exhaustion that embeds in after the 3rd cycle of compressions, and learn just how to exchange functions cleanly with a partner.

When I teach bronchial asthma emergency treatment, I maintain a spacer on hand and ask individuals to coach a "worried" individual via four smokes spaced by four breaths each, after that to reassess and repeat. The initial attempt is typically messy. The 2nd comes to be smoother. By the 3rd, people locate their voice and timing. That is when training ends up being muscle memory.

Scenarios additionally permit you to check out edge cases. A fine example is choking with a partial obstruction. The impulse is to do something remarkable. The right activity can be to keep the person coughing, avoid back strikes till the coughing stops working or the individual collapses, and be ready to change to breast compressions if they pass out. Educating that acknowledges this gray location, rather than paint every emergency situation in black and white, generates safer first responders.

CPR that works under pressure

The core of m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training course Oxley participants favour is straightforward: push hard, push quick, allow the breast recoil, lessen disturbances, and utilize an AED as quickly as it gets here. The complexity lies in the information that actual scenes toss at you.

Rhythm is one. Songs or checking can help, however the proper way to internalize 100 to 120 compressions per minute is to practice with a metronome and feedback manikins. Many Oxley first aid training courses utilize devices that measure depth and price. When participants see a green light or hear a tone, they find out the distinction in between "feels right" and "is right". It is common for solid grownups to under-compress on a firm surface, and for smaller sized rescuers to fret about pressing as well hard. Purpose feedback brings every person into the risk-free zone.

Another detail is hand positioning on various physique. For a broad-chested adult, it is easy to set the heel of your hand in the center between the nipple areas. On smaller sized frames, spots really feel closer together and you might worry about ribs. Trainers need to stabilize this pain and show that proper strategy prioritizes compressing the reduced half of the sternum with locked elbows and your shoulders piled over your hands. If you are in uncertainty in the field, start compressions; reluctance is the real risk.

Finally, rescue breaths in the adult series are optional for untrained responders. In programs, it is still beneficial to understand exactly how to create a seal and provide visible breast rise. That understanding issues for pediatric situations, drownings, and particular asphyxial arrests where oxygenation plays a bigger role. The factor is not to produce dogma, but to gear up people to make good options fast.

First help and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ation for families

Parents ask superb, functional questions. Just how hard do I press on my kid's chest? What happens if my child throws up in the center of CPR? Do I ever thump a baby's back? A first aid and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training course Oxley families trust fund will give solutions you can keep at 3 a.m.

For infants, the series changes. You use 2 fingers on the breast bone for compressions at a depth of concerning one third of the breast, approximately 4 centimeters, and breaths are gentle puffs. If an infant chokes and can not cry or cough, you place the child face down along your forearm, support the jaw, and supply up to 5 sharp back strikes in between the shoulder blades, checking after each. If that falls short, transform the baby face up and give up to 5 chest drives. These interventions should be exercised on baby manikins. Seeing and feeling them as soon as deserves pages of created instruction.

Allergy and anaphylaxis prevail in school-age youngsters. Trainers should educate quick acknowledgment: skin flushing, swelling of the lips or tongue, loud breathing, lightheadedness, falling down. The response is easy and urgent: adrenaline initially with an auto-injector, then call emergency solutions, after that second-line therapies like antihistamines or puffers if recommended. Individuals often stress over "excessive using" adrenaline. It is an incorrect concern. When the signs indicate anaphylaxis, make use of the tool. Extra doses can be provided after 5 mins if signs and symptoms continue or aggravate, and paramedics will certainly replace there.

Oxley-specific factors to consider worth training for

Every location has patterns. In Oxley, I see a few repeating themes.

Heat and dehydration hit harder than people anticipate during weekend sport and summer season work. First aiders ought to be comfortable acknowledging heat fatigue versus warm stroke, cooling boldy when required with water, color, and air motion, and recognizing when to escalate.

Roadside events are not unusual on arterial routes. Scene safety and security here is not a disposable line. You require to regulate web traffic preferably, make use of risk lights and triangles, and area on your own in a position that does not subject you to a second collision. Handwear covers are useful, but your eyes and recognition are your initial protection.

Manual handling injuries turn up in logistics and profession duties. While emergency treatment does not replace safer training strategies, it does show you just how to sustain a coworker with a presumed back injury, when to prevent moving them, and how to monitor for delayed red flags like increasing discomfort, tingling, or weakness.

Sports injuries run from strains to misplacements. Ice and compression work, but it is the calm assessment that stops a minor sprain from developing into a three-week lack because someone tried to "run it off" without examining stability.

A few functional suggestions you can make use of today

Training is best, however there are small steps you can take immediately.

    Check the closest AED to your home or workplace, and learn how to open the cabinet. Numerous are not locked. If a code is needed, store it where every person can locate it. Put a picture of your home's front from the road into your phone. In an emergency call, you or a family member can explain landmarks swiftly to lead responders. Place a fundamental first aid set in your vehicle and add 2 sets of gloves, a face guard, and a couple of big wound dressings. Restore what you utilize, and note expiration days as soon as a year. Save emergency get in touches with under ICE, and include clinical conditions or allergic reactions in your phone's clinical ID. Schedule your following m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training courses Oxley session before your existing certificate runs out, and welcome a coworker to join you.

These habits are not a substitute for training, but they make your training smoother and your reaction cleaner.
